but before diving in… would like to hear from anyone here… on issues with 9.*

I think this will depend on a number of factors, some of which have to do with your OS. For me, the last usable version of LC9 is dp6, which is dated 8 March, so has no bugfixes or new features in the last six months. While dp6 is the version I've standardized on for new work, I can't recommend it for anything other than experimenting with new features. In particular, extensions are not binary-compatible between LC8 and LC9, which means I have two separate folders for user plugins, etc. This is more of a pain than it appears, because LC8 and LC9 share the same preferences file, so I have to switch preferences from the IDE when moving between the two versions.

That said, dp6 seems pretty stable to me, so if you don't mind being six months out of date, it's worth a look, especially if you can install it on a separate machine or VM. I wouldn't trust production-ready code to it, though.
